Overview
ISO 27368:2008 is an International Standard from ISO that specifies analytical methods for detecting two primary asphyxiant toxicants-carbon monoxide (CO) and hydrogen cyanide (HCN)-in blood samples collected from fire casualties. In blood, CO is measured as carboxyhaemoglobin (COHb) and HCN as cyanide ion (CN−). These gases are major contributors to the toxic effects of smoke inhalation during fires, and their accurate detection is crucial for forensic analysis, emergency medicine, and fire safety research.
This standard outlines trusted, well-established laboratory procedures for analyzing both ante-mortem and post-mortem blood samples. It takes into account analytical factors such as robustness, repeatability, reproducibility, effectiveness, and the types of instruments suitable for these analyses. Recommendations for sample collection, storage, analysis, and quality control are also included, ensuring the integrity and reliability of results.

Applications
-
Forensic Toxicology
ISO 27368:2008 provides tools for accurate forensic investigation of fire-related injuries and deaths, helping to determine the cause and manner of death by quantifying blood levels of CO and HCN.
-
Emergency Medicine and Clinical Toxicology
Enables rapid assessment of fire victims exposed to smoke, supporting diagnosis and immediate treatment for smoke inhalation injuries and asphyxiant poisoning.
-
Fire Safety Research and Regulation
Assists researchers and regulatory bodies in assessing the toxic danger of building materials and fire environments by linking atmospheric measurements with actual blood toxicant levels.
-
Public Health and Statistical Analysis
Provides standardized data for fire statistics, contributing to the development of fire safety standards, regulatory policy, and improvements in building material selection and emergency response planning.
Related Standards
The methods and principles outlined in ISO 27368:2008 are closely linked to several important standards in fire safety and analytical chemistry, including:
- ISO 19701: Methods for sampling and analysis of fire effluents
- ISO 13344: Estimation of the lethal toxic potency of fire effluents
- ISO/TS 13571: Life-threatening components of fire – Guidelines for estimation of time available for escape
- ISO 13943: Fire safety vocabulary
- ISO 3696: Water for analytical laboratory use – Specification and test methods
These related standards support comprehensive approaches to fire safety, analytical best practices, and terminology consistency.
